    Best Looking: G/FORE Gallivanter

    GFORE Gallivanter Shoes-9
    A pretty outstanding looking pair of golf shoes.

    I think the Gallivanter is the best-looking golf shoe on the market.

    To me, this is that rare shoe that marries traditional and modern styling in a way that actually works. It definitely gives off a traditional vibe, but there’s also just enough edge with details like the skull-and-crossbones sole to keep it from feeling too buttoned-up.

    The build quality is completely first-rate. No surprise there as that’s pretty much the G/FORE story in a nutshell. But the Gallivanters take things to another level. The pebbled leather feels high-end, and it actually cleans up very easily.

    And these shoes were shockingly comfortable right out of the box.

    The grip is phenomenal too. As a spiked shoe, you feel planted and stable in a way that you just don’t get with spikeless golf shoes. And for even more traction, you can go with the Gallivanter G/LOCKs, which include the more traditional removable spikes.

    Best All-Day Golf Shoe: G/FORE MG4x2

    GFORE MG4x2 Shoes
    Wearable in pretty much whatever daily situation, including golf of course.

    I used to think I’d never be the guy who wore their golf shoes off the golf course on a regular basis.

    But the MG4x2 changed that for me.

    These are true crossover shoes. You legitimately can wear them on a plane, around town, out to dinner, and of course on the golf course. I’ve worn them in every one of those situations.

    These are among the most versatile golf shoes I own. And now having them in my rotation for more than a year, I can say they’re some of my overall most-worn shoes.

    Comfort is outstanding. The sole is softer than most running shoes, which makes them incredibly comfortable to walk around in all day.

    And like all G/FORE shoes, the MG4x2s have little massaging nubs in the insole. If you’ve never experienced them, they’re like little pressure points that feel like a foot massage with every step you take. I’m telling you, it’s amazing.

    On the course, they performed better than I expected from an all-day shoe. The traction is surprisingly good, and I’ve had no issues with slipping even in dewy morning conditions. They’re not going to have the same absolute grip and stability as a spiked option, but that’s not what they’re built for.

    What they are built for is versatility. And G/FORE definitely nailed it with that objective. I’ve worn these shoes traveling, golfing, out with friends, and even to a college football game. 

    I will say that the styling is a bit bold, which again is kind of G/FORE’s thing. There’s a lot going on with the speckled midsole and color blocking. But it’s grown on me to the point where I now genuinely love it.

    One quick note: The white mesh of my particular model does get dirty pretty easily. It’s nothing a little shoe cleaner can’t handle, but if you’re hard on your shoes, you might want to consider going with a darker colorway.

    I’m not saying these are likely to be your only pair of golf shoes. But if you want a pair that you can do just about anything in, these are it.

    My Personal Favorite Right Now: G/FORE G.112

    For the longest time, I ignored the G.112s.

    I’d see them and think they looked cool, but I just thought they might be too much style and not enough substance. Maybe just a little too casual to be a serious golf shoe.

    That was a mistake.

    After now putting a bunch of rounds on these, including three out of four rounds on a trip to Ballyneal, I can say without hesitation that the G.112s are completely legit.

    What surprised me most was the breathability. The perforated version I’ve been wearing has venting across the upper that makes a big difference. Walking 36 holes at Ballyneal in 90-degree weather, my feet stayed cool and comfortable the whole time.

    They’re also way more comfortable for long walks than I expected. Definitely more flexible and less structured than something like the MG4+. And of course you get G/FORE’s signature nubbed insoles.

    Performance-wise, they held up better than I thought they would. Even on uneven lies or rugged terrain, they stayed locked in. I’ve had no issues with support or stability.

    And, for the record, I broke 80 for the first time in two years wearing these shoes.

    I think the style hits a nice balance too. From one angle, they look clean and minimalist, almost like Stan Smiths. But turn them and you get G/FORE’s distinctive angular sole design and pops of color. They’re kind of subtle and loud at the same time.

    Personally, I find the color pop to be just right.

    Best for Wider Toe Box: G/18

    This shoe runs roomier than an option like the MG4+ or Gallivanter. You notice it immediately in the toe box. So if you’ve got wider feet or you just prefer a less snug fit, this is the model to look at.

    The G/18 is also one of the most fashion-forward shoes in the G/FORE line. You’ve got the “Play Nice” emblazoned across the toe boxes, the raised G/FORE logo on the heel, and a textured sole that wraps all the way around to the front of the shoe.

    Out of the box, the build quality is excellent. Everything about this shoe feels high-end. The materials are premium, and the construction is as good as anything G/FORE makes.

    As for performance, these surprised me. The spikeless sole provides better traction than you’d expect. The grip goes a step above what you get with the MG4+, though it’s obviously not quite at the level of a spiked shoe.

    Comfort is also excellent. Typical G/FORE. And there’s been no break-in period required at all.

    I know the styling’s not going to be for everyone. It’s definitely a bold shoe. But if you’re cool with that and you need a wider fit, this is a fantastic golf shoe.

    Best for Most People: MG4+ O2

    If I had to recommend one G/FORE shoe to most golfers, it’d be the MG4+ O2.

    This is the best blend of comfort, performance, and looks in the lineup. It’s a shoe that works for almost everyone.

    The original MG4+ was my most worn shoe in 2023. So when G/FORE released this updated O2 version, I was curious if they could actually improve on something I already thought was exceptional.

    They did.

    The traction in the MG4+ O2 is as close to a spiked shoe as I’ve experienced with a spikeless option. My first round with them was a wet morning with heavy dew everywhere, and I didn’t slip once. The sawtooth sole pattern is incredibly effective.

    Comfort is also outstanding. Of course you get those massaging nubs in the insole, and this shoe’s got a triple-density foam bed that makes it feel like you’re walking on pillows.

    I also like that there’s a ton of padding around the heel collar. I especially appreciated that after wearing less comfortable shoes right before testing these.

    One note about sizing. I wear a 12. And while these fit me true to size, they did feel slightly snug on first wear. After 18 holes, they relaxed and felt perfect. But just calling that out. If you’ve got wider feet, you might want to consider going half a size up.

    G/FORE also makes a spiked G/Lock version of this exact shoe if you want maximum traction. But I think that, for most people, the MG4+ O2 spikeless is the sweet spot.

    Final Thoughts on the Best G/FORE Golf Shoes

    Here’s what I’ve come to realize about G/FORE: If you like the way the shoe looks, you’re probably going to love the shoe.

    Every model in their lineup has the same attention to detail, the same build quality, and the same commitment to premium materials.

    But each one definitely has its own vibe and purpose.

    If you want traditional style with modern comfort, I like the Gallivanters.

    If you need something you can wear all day, on or off the course, I think the MG4x2 is an easy choice.

    If you’re looking for a casual, breathable shoe that still performs, don’t make the mistake I did of sleeping on the G.112.

    If you’ve got wider feet or you want a bolder look, consider the G/18.

    And if you want what I think is the all-around best performance in a spikeless shoe for most people, it’s the MG4+ O2.
